π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

10 items
  • 240 ml Low fat plain yogurt
  • 15 ml Extra virgin olive oil
  • 15 ml Lemon juice
  • 5 g Dijon mustard
  • 10 ml Honey
  • 1 clove Garlic, minced
  • 1 g Salt
  • 1 g Black pepper
  • 5 g Fresh dill, chopped
  • 5 g Fresh parsley, chopped

πŸ“ Instructions

9 steps
1

In a medium-sized mixing bowl, add the low fat plain yogurt to act as the creamy base for the dressing.

2

Slowly drizzle in the extra virgin olive oil while whisking continuously to emulsify the mixture. This ensures that the oil is well combined with the yogurt.

3

Add the lemon juice to the bowl along with Dijon mustard and honey. Whisk them together until fully integrated. The lemon juice adds a tangy flavor, while the honey provides a hint of sweetness, balancing out the flavors.

4

Stir in the minced garlic and season the mixture with salt and black pepper according to your taste preference.

5

Fold in the freshly chopped dill and parsley into the dressing. This will give the dressing a fresh, herby flavor.

6

Taste the dressing and adjust the seasoning if needed. You can add more lemon juice for tang, honey for sweetness, or salt and pepper as desired.

7

Transfer the dressing to a jar or airtight container for storage.

8

Refrigerate the dressing for at least 30 minutes before serving to allow the flavors to meld together.

9

Serve as a dressing over salads or use as a spread for sandwiches and wraps. Enjoy!
